Larnaca mayor questions progress and transparency of port and marina project

Larnaca Mayor Andreas Vyras has publicly challenged claims made by Minister of Transport Alexis Vafeadis regarding the renovation of the city's marina and port infrastructure. Vyras asserted that, contrary to official statements, no formal tender process for significant infrastructure repairs has been initiated, noting only minor makeshift fixes. During a meeting held on April 16 with the Minister and Larnaca EOA President Angelos Chatzicharalambous, it was agreed that a corrected study would be presented by early May, followed by an analytical master plan by late June. Vyras questioned the readiness of the docking projects, specifically asking if complete construction designs, wave impact studies, and essential utility plans for water, electricity, and internet are finalized. He highlighted that he seeks transparency and clear commitments rather than public confrontation. The Mayor demanded clarification on whether current studies cover only the docking area or the entire scope of the development. These questions remain unanswered, leading Vyras to query the basis upon which local authorities are being asked to consent to the proposed works.
